Perovskia Atriplicifolia Blue Spire Russian Sage is an erect small deciduous sub-shrub to 1.2m, with white stems bearing deeply-divided, aromatic greyish leaves. Small violet-blue flowers in large plumy panicles in late summer and autumn. Grows well in poor but well-drained soils in full sun. Drought Resistant, Mediterranean Climate Plants, Low Maintenance, Cottage/Informal Garden, City/Courtyard Gardens or Ground Cover. Pest and Disease free.
Ultimate height: 1-1.5 metres.
Ultimate spread: 0.5-1 metres.
Time to ultimate height: 2-5 years.
